Daisy decided to do some reading of some Quidditch magazines in order to relax. She ventured her way to the courtyard and sat down on one of the stone benches. She hoped to cross paths with Skylar and to mend things between them but she had to admit that she was nervous. What if her recent loss affected how she treated the Slytherin? Well, she would cross that bridge when she came to it.
So yes Skylar was a tad abrupt with the younger Hufflepuff on the train home a few months ago and while she PROBABLY should have felt bad, she also didn't. No offense, but while she liked Daisy well enough, she didn't care to discuss her relationship issues and doubts with her. Not just after the letter and the conversation with the ex. Not before having time to really process her feelings, which thankfully summer provided her the opportunity to really grow and explore her feelings with the present boyfriend.

Was she going to talk about what happened on the train now, should she run into Daisy? Absolutely not. It was in the past. But would she be polite to the younger girl if she ran across her? Sure. Especially considering the owl she'd seen leaving from her spot at the feast, which had the seventh year curious.

Not too curious though to broach the subject, as she spotted her reading a quidditch magazine. "Hey. That's a good one." She said, inclining her head at the magazine she was reading, taking a seat on the stone bench. "You trying out again?" She could offer advice, ya know? As a captain. But then again, Daisy was also an opponent too.
